A beautifully presented first floor apartment, situated in the ever-popular Waterside Court development in Fleet, ideally positioned just a short distance from Fleet railway station, Fleet Pond and within easy reach of the town centre and its excellent range of shops, cafés and amenities. This particular apartment has been thoughtfully updated and tastefully decorated throughout, creating a stylish and welcoming home ready to move straight into. The bright and spacious living area provides an excellent space to relax or entertain, while the well-appointed kitchen is both practical and neatly presented. There are two well-proportioned bedrooms, complemented by a recently refitted bathroom finished to a high standard. Further benefits include updated electric radiators offering improved efficiency and comfort all year round.

Waterside Court itself is a well-maintained and established development, set within attractive communal grounds with neatly kept communal areas and residents’ parking. The setting offers a rare balance of convenience and greenery, with pleasant waterside walks moments away, while the station and town centre remain comfortably accessible.

An ideal purchase for first-time buyers, investors or those looking to downsize, all set within a highly convenient and sought-after Fleet location.
